An uncontested divorce is a process where both spouses agree on the terms of their separation, leading to a smoother and more expeditious legal outcome. In South Africa, these divorces are governed by the Divorce Act, which outlines the requirements and procedures for individuals seeking an mutually agreeable divorce.
Starting an uncontested divorce in South Africa, individuals must first meet certain requirements, such as being in a recognized marital union and residing separately for at least six months.
- Once these requirements are met, the parties can file a joint application to the court outlining their common terms for divorce. This petition typically details provisions regarding asset allocation, spousal maintenance, and arrangements for the care of children.
- Upon the event that the court concludes that the application meets all legal criteria, it will grant the divorce decree, officially ending the marriage.
During this process, it is highly recommended for individuals to seek legal counsel. An experienced family lawyer can advise them through the intricacies of South African divorce law and ensure that their legal standing are protected.

Easy & Budget-Friendly Divorce Options in South Africa
Navigating a divorce can be challenging, especially check here when finances are a factor. Luckily, there are numerous quick and affordable divorce solutions available in South Africa. Firstly, you could explore negotiation, which allows couples to reach an agreement outside of court. This can be a affordable option compared to a traditional legal battle.
Additionally, South Africa offers fast-track divorce applications for couples who are in agreement on all terms. These options can significantly reduce the time and financial burden involved in the process.
Before making any decisions, it's crucial to consult with a qualified legal professional who can provide personalized advice based on your specific circumstances. They can help you understand your rights and consider all available options to ensure a smooth and affordable divorce process.
